Canelo Alvarez vs. William Scull: A Detailed Analysis

The boxing world witnessed a significant event on May 3, 2025, as Saul “Canelo” Alvarez faced William Scull in a highly anticipated match. This fight, held in Riyadh, Saudi Arabia, marked Canelo’s first bout outside of Mexico and the United States. The event was broadcasted live on DAZN pay-per-view, with the main card starting at 5:45 p.m. ET and the ring walks for the main event expected at 11 p.m. ET. The Build-Up and Context

The fight between Canelo Alvarez and William Scull was more than just a boxing match; it was a culmination of strategic maneuvers and title disputes. Canelo, the unified super middleweight champion, was stripped of his IBF title last fall for choosing to fight Edgar Berlanga rather than making his mandatory defense against Scull. This decision set the stage for a highly anticipated showdown, with both fighters eager to prove their superiority in the ring.

Scull, on the other hand, had earned his shot at the title by outpointing Vladimir Shishkin for the vacant IBF title. This victory solidified his status as a formidable opponent, capable of challenging the likes of Canelo. The Fight: A Clash of Titans

The main event began with both fighters displaying their strengths. Canelo, known for his technical prowess and strategic fighting style, kept his distance and reached for uppercuts. Scull, despite having fewer fights under his belt, looked sharp and determined. The early rounds were closely contested, with both fighters landing significant punches and displaying their defensive skills.

As the fight progressed, Canelo’s experience and ring IQ became evident. He managed to outbox Scull, using his jab effectively and landing powerful combinations. Scull, however, showed resilience and managed to land some solid shots, keeping the fight competitive. The judges’ scorecards reflected the close nature of the fight, with scores of 115-113, 116-112, and 119-109 in favor of Canelo.
